Chapter 24

The following day, Antonio summoned Bethany to his office and asked, Beth, I heard you had a runin with William yesterday.

Bethany smiled gently. Did he tattle, Uncle Antonio?

Antonio didn’t expect her to be so blunt, and it threw him off for a moment. Oh, no. I heard it from someone else. Even if work in the HR department isn’t exactly hectic, maintaining a good team dynamic is still important. Beth, you were parachuted into the position, so it’s natural for people to have opinions.

However, Bethany didn’t back down. Uncle Antonio, first of all, if he really tattled to you, that’s jumping the chain of command. Many companies, especially foreign ones, hate that. Second, if he hadn’t, it meant that I handled things just fine.

She paused, then added calmly, This is a company, Uncle Antonio. There’s room for all kinds of people here, but what a company needs are people who follow orders well, right?

Antonio seemed surprised. He hadn’t expected his 25yearold niece to say something like that.

His gaze turned dark. It looks like you’ve put in quite a bit of work this time, Beth.

Not really.Bethany flashed a smile. Uncle Antonio, the company wouldn’t have grown from a single hotel into a whole chain without everything you’ve invested in it. I came back to see the business my dad builtand to help the company keep moving forward. We want the same thing.

Her words gave Antonio a quiet satisfaction. Mm, Beth. I can tell you really care.

As for William, that was the end of it.

William assumed that by spreading those rumors, he would at least cause Bethany some trouble.

However, when he saw her return to the office completely unfazed and start posting this month’s task assignments in the group chat, he began to panic.

Did his performance bonus really get docked for nothing?

Bethany ignored William completely, treating him as if he were invisible.

There were plenty of staff who could work. She didn’t have to ask William for help.

At noon, Holly unexpectedly called Bethany.

She suggested, Beth, let’s go camping tomorrow. It’s been ages since we last went out for some fun!

Bethany mulled it over. It was Saturday tomorrow, so her schedule should be wide open. Thus, she said, Sure, count me in.

The two of them settled on a time. Holly offered to pick her up, and Bethany didn’t think much about it.

The following day, when Noah’s familiar car rolled to a stop at their meeting spot, Bethany pressed her lips together, her expression unreadable.

Beth, hop in!Holly invited warmly.

She was here that day to be the peacemaker.

Bethany had previously had a bit of a misunderstanding with Noah, which is why Holly arranged this meeting.

Most of the people who were going that day were Noah’s friends. So, Holly figured that it wouldn’t be awkward if she brought Bethany and another friend along.
